The American Marquetry Society (AMS) is a nonprofit corporation devoted to advancing the art and craft of marquetry. Our goal is to promote, inform and educate the general public about this unique art form.

Founded in 1997, we currently have several regional Chapters located throughout the United States and our membership is scattered worldwide. We openly welcome anyone interested in marquetry, from the enthusiastic beginner to the skilled marquetarian.

The AMS publishes a quarterly Magazine called The American Marquetarian devoted to distributing helpful information about marquetry. Each issue offers a variety of information such as... 
  • Marquetry related articles
  • Marquetry techniques & tips
  • Projects for the marquetarian
  • Questions and answers column
  • Sample patterns
  • Regional news and updates
